beg to ask a favor of; to plead for.
branch a woody part of a tree or bush that grows out from the trunk.
choir a group of people who sing together, especially a group that sings religious music; chorus.
cook to prepare food for eating by using heat.
harvest the gathering of ripe crops, or the amount gathered.
hunt to search for and try to kill (animals) for food or sport.
lobby to try to influence people who make laws to vote in a way that supports what the group wants.
mouth the part of the body through which an animal eats, breathes, and makes sounds. The mouth is on the face below the nose.
often at frequent times.
owe to have to pay; be in debt to someone.
past all of the time before now.
peek to look for a short time or in secret.
pen a long, thin tool used for writing or drawing in ink.
pond a small body of still water.
school a place for teaching and learning.
